The North African desert, particularly the Sahara, is characterized by vast stretches of arid land, dramatic sand dunes, and sparse vegetation. Temperatures can soar during the day, often exceeding 100°F (38°C), while nights can be surprisingly cold. The landscape is strikingly beautiful, with unique rock formations and occasional oases that provide a stark contrast to the surrounding dryness. Wildlife is limited but adapted to the harsh conditions, and the region's nomadic cultures have a rich history tied to the desert environment.
